     Your Committee on Finance, to which was referred H.B. No. 1638, H.D. 1, entitled:

 

"A BILL FOR AN ACT RELATING TO THE JUDICIARY,"

 

begs leave to report as follows:

 

     The purpose of this measure is to appropriate supplemental funds for the operating and capital improvement costs of the Judicial Branch for Fiscal Year (FY) 2014-2015.

 

     The State of Hawaii Judiciary and Office of the Prosecuting Attorney, County of Hawaii testified in support of this measure.  The County of Hawaii Office of the Mayor, West Hawaii Bar Association, Hawaii State Bar Association, PHOCUSED, and an individual provided comments.

 

     Your Committee supports the Judiciary's efforts to increase services to the public and has appropriated the following amounts:

 

     (1)  $789,000 to the First Circuit for purchase of service contracts to provide essential treatment to adult and juvenile offenders and their victims;

 

     (2)  $70,000 to the Second Circuit to increase guardian ad litem and legal counsel services for indigent parties;

 

     (3)  $198,493 and two social worker positions to expand mental health programs that serve clients with serious mental illness or with co-occurring mental health and substance use disorders;

 

     (4)  $152,788 and two social worker assistant positions to ensure continuation of periodic drug testing of offenders in the Judiciary's project Hawaii's Opportunity Probation with Enforcement Program;

 

     (5)  $94,900 to replace equipment used to interview children who are victims of or are affected by domestic violence, custody, or safety issues; and

 

     (6)  $1,700,000 to restructure the budget of the Judiciary to facilitate reclassification of critical positions, eliminate vacancies, and restore operational stability.

 

Your Committee also recommends total appropriations for the 2013-2015 fiscal biennium of $54,015,000 in general obligation bonds.
